Event-driven architecture (EDA) is a software architecture pattern promoting the production, detection, consumption of, and reaction to events. In this pattern, systems are designed to respond to state changes asynchronously through event messages. EDA enables loose coupling between services and is widely used in microservices, real-time data processing, and distributed systems. Foundational specifications include AsyncAPI for describing event-driven APIs and CNCF CloudEvents for a common event format.
